a scuba tank has a pressure of 195 atm at a temperature of 10 degree Celsius. The volume of the tank is 350 L. How many moles of
larisa86 [58]
To determine the number of moles of air present in the tank, we assume that air is an ideal gas in order for us to use the following equation,
                                        n = PV/RT
Substituting the known values,
                        n = (195 atm)(350 L) / (0.0821 L.atm/mol.K)(10 + 273.15 K)
                                        n = 2935.91 moles
Thus, the number of moles of air is approximately 2935.91 moles.
